首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

DukTape ` `require()`抛出` `TypeError:未定义不可调用`

DukTape是一个轻量级的JavaScript引擎,可以嵌入到C/C++应用程序中。它的主要特点是小巧灵活,适用于嵌入式设备和资源受限的环境中。DukTape支持CommonJS模块规范,其中require()函数用于加载和导入模块。

当执行require()函数时,抛出TypeError:未定义不可调用错误通常表示模块未定义或者导入路径不正确。这可能是因为未正确安装或配置相关的依赖模块,或者导入路径错误。解决此错误的方法如下:

  1. 确保相关的依赖模块已经正确安装和配置。可以使用包管理工具(如npm)来安装所需模块,并确保正确声明了依赖关系。
  2. 检查导入路径是否正确。确保导入路径的大小写、文件路径和文件名是否正确,并且确保所需的模块文件存在于指定的路径中。
  3. 确保所需的模块已经正确导出。模块需要通过module.exportsexports对象导出,以便其他模块可以正确加载和使用。

对于DukTape在腾讯云的相关产品和产品介绍链接地址,目前并没有直接相关的腾讯云产品可以提供。然而,腾讯云提供了一系列与云计算和JavaScript相关的产品和服务,如云函数(Serverless)、云开发、云存储、人工智能服务等,可以帮助开发者构建和部署基于JavaScript的应用。具体了解可以参考腾讯云官方文档:https://cloud.tencent.com/document/product

请注意,在回答问题时,我们已经避免了提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。如果你需要进一步了解这些品牌商相关的信息,可以通过官方网站和文档进行查询。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券